India favourites to win the World Cup, claims Deep Dasgupta
Former
India player Deep Dasgupta has said that India is able to win the World Cup
trophy once again if the 2023 edition of the mega event will take place
tomorrow. However, he was referring to India’s stunning form which helped them
beat the current World Champions England 2-1 in a three-match ODI series.
“I think India is in a very good position as
far as ODIs are concerned, they will be in the top 3. Also, the heartening
thing is the way the youngsters delivered. They are pushing people who are
incumbent. For example, Shikhar, someone like Padikkal, Shaw scoring those runs
in Vijay Hazare Trophy. You already have Mayank (Agarwal), KL (Rahul). There is
a healthy competition there. It augurs well for Indian cricket,” Dasgupta told India Today.
“Also, the
World Cup is going to happen in 2023 November, even if the World Cup is going
to happen tomorrow, India is still one of the favourites to win it. In 2023,
things will only get better,” he shared.
India won
the World Cup in 2011 by beating Sri Lanka in Mumbai under the leadership of MS
Dhoni and on April 2, the entire nation celebrated a decade of India’s World
Cup victory as well. Since the 2023 edition will be played in India only,
everyone would love to see India repeat 2011 as well.
However, he
also said that India should play the way they are known to play and they don’t
necessarily have to follow any other team as well. “The players we have, like
Shikhar, Rohit and Virat, their strike rate would be around 80 but by the time they
play 30-40 balls, their strike would be 120. So it is not necessary, do you
have to follow,” Dasgupta again shared.
Currently,
the players are busy with the upcoming edition of the Indian Premier League, starting from April 9. After that, they will travel to England for
the inaugural World Test Championship final where they will take on New Zealand
in June.
